: It automates the hardware calibration process (AutoCal) by directly accessing the TV's internal Look Up Tables (LUTs).
One of the most valuable features of Calman Home for LG is AutoCal—the ability to automatically calibrate the TV via an IP connection. Cracked versions frequently break this functionality because AutoCal requires communication with Portrait Displays' licensing servers.
